Elementos de competitividad sistémica y la relación costo privado

2019 
Competitiveness consists of the ability to sell a product in a market in which there are similar ones and to maintain said customer during the desired time. To measure the competitiveness of companies, there are several methodologies that have evolved over time. An appropriate way to identify the elements that make up the competitiveness of the organization is through the systemic study of it. In addition, if studies of economic indicators are added, the analysis would be more complete. The objective of this paper is to present the variables of systemic competitiveness and private cost through a process of documentary research. A description and analysis of elements of competitive advantage, comparative advantage and systemic competitiveness is presented. Finally, the study of the private cost variables is carried out.
